Output 6e1a75460dda9dddbe974d937036c369e77131066e0adb8f73bbc3166e02b139:0

value
398485346
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91f7cf50dd984d48a9823835f9c4506704a4ec61 OP_EQUALVERIFY OP_CHECKSIG
address
1EJoqwkvSzjyT8ii3PiLMuyWPZVGYgpLQe
transaction
6e1a75460dda9dddbe974d937036c369e77131066e0adb8f73bbc3166e02b139
spent
true